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 349 64
87 36631602246 87105176
87 36631602246 87105176
9628980 1918431 7075189380
All about undefined
Interested in learning more?
87 36631602246 87105176
9628980 1918431 7075189380
See more
48247582980 5123924
03625004 072 1259479
See more
5304838 2162357 96734
8565403382 88815068054 794 4027261
See more